Basic information Supplier

2114335-58-7(tert-Butyl 5-(tetramethyl-1,3,2-dioxaborolan-2-yl)pentanoate)

Basic information Supplier
2114335-58-7 Basic informationMore

Browse by Nationality 2114335-58-7 Suppliers >China suppliers

Recommend You Select Member Companies